Overview

Despite its small size, Connecticut packs a surprising amount of birding diversity into its coastline, river valleys, and upland forests. The Long Island Sound shore provides critical habitat for wintering sea ducks and migrant shorebirds, while inland forests host breeding warblers and the state's growing Bald Eagle population. Seasonal Birding Guide

Warbler migration peaks in mid-May along the coast and river valleys. Shorebirds move through tidal flats.

Breeding Cerulean Warblers and Worm-eating Warblers are found in mature forest tracts. Terns nest on offshore islands.

Hawk migration is strong at coastal watch points like Lighthouse Point. Sparrows fill the coastal scrub.

Long Island Sound hosts scoters, eiders, and Harlequin Ducks. Snowy Owls visit coastal beaches in irruption years.
